Step 1: Start with a clean canvas

Before you begin creating your dream eyebrows, start with a clean canvas. Make sure your eyebrows are free of any dirt, makeup, or oil. You can use a makeup remover or a facial cleanser to clean your eyebrows thoroughly.

Step 2: Determine your eyebrow shape

Next, you need to figure out the shape you want for your eyebrows. There are different eyebrow shapes, such as arched, straight, or curved. The shape of your eyebrows should complement your face shape. For example, if you have a round face, you should go for an arched eyebrow shape to balance out your features.

Step 3: Choose the right eyebrow product

There are different products you can use to do eyebrow makeup, such as eyebrow pencils, brow gels, powders, and pomades. Choose a product that matches the color of your eyebrows, or you can go a shade lighter to achieve a look.

Step 4: Outline your eyebrows

Once you have determined your eyebrow shape and have chosen the right product, you can start outlining your eyebrows. Use a light hand and draw small, feathery strokes to create a natural-looking eyebrow. Start from the bottom of your eyebrow and work your way upwards. Avoid drawing a straight line as it can look too harsh.

Step 5: Fill in the gaps

After outlining your eyebrows, you can fill in any gaps. Use a light hand and draw small strokes to mimic the look of natural hair. Avoid making the eyebrows too thick, as it can look unnatural. If you have sparse eyebrows, you can use a brow gel to add volume and texture.

Step 6: Blend the product

Once you have filled in your eyebrows, you need to blend the product to achieve a natural look. Use a spoolie brush or a clean mascara wand to blend the product gently.

Step 7: Set the eyebrows

To ensure your eyebrows stay in place all day, you need to set them. You can use a clear brow gel or a tinted one, depending on your preference.

Step 8: Clean up any mistakes

Lastly, clean up any mistakes you may have made while doing your eyebrow makeup. You can use a concealer or foundation to clean up any smudges or mistakes.
